Pick match statement without creating an extra expression

Dear Qlik user

I have a pick match statement which counts a number of patients by a category based on a button selection

I.e. Pick(Match(v_selected1,2,3),$(Count_Day), $(Count_Emerg), $(Count_IP)))

I would like to know whether it is possible to use a second field to show the number of patients who died from filed IP_Discharge_Method without having to rewrite my expressions

I.e. If(IP_Discharge_Method=Died(Pick(Match(v_selected1,2,3),$(Count_Day), $(Count_Emerg), $(Count_IP)))

I assume that your variables within the pick-part are expressions. And there you could add something like:

... IP_Discharge_Method = {'Died'} ...


to apply this condition or maybe:


... IP_Discharge_Method = p(IP_Discharge_Method) ...


to be more flexible and just select which values should be included within the condition.
